Rim Lock Replacement: A Comprehensive Guide to Upgrade Your Security
Rim locks have actually long been a staple in securing homes, businesses, and various properties. This locking mechanism is installed directly on the surface area of a door, making it relatively simple to install and change. As with any hardware, rim locks can break in time or may become outdated in regards to security. Comprehending how to successfully replace a rim lock can enhance your security steps and give you assurance. This article will provide a comprehensive summary of rim locks, the replacement procedure, and offer answers to often asked questions.
Understanding Rim LocksWhat is a Rim Lock?
A rim lock is a kind of surface-mounted lock that secures a door with a secret. Unlike mortise locks, which are installed within the door itself, rim locks are normally affixed to the door's surface area. This particular not only makes them much easier to set up but likewise permits easy replacement when needed.

Numerous reasons might compel homeowner to think about replacing their rim locks:
Wear and Tear: Over time, elements can suffer from wear leading to malfunction.Security Upgrade: Advances in locking technology can provide exceptional security functions.Lost Keys: If secrets are lost or taken, replacing the lock is a sensible safety measure.Visual Changes: A new lock can complement remodellings or style updates to the door.How to Replace a Rim Lock: Step-by-Step GuideTools and Materials NeededNew rim lock lockset ScrewdriverDrill (if essential)Measuring tapeWood chisel (optional)Step 1: Gather Necessary Tools
Before starting the job, collect all required tools. Guarantee you have a new rim lock suitable with your door size and thickness.
Action 2: Remove the Old Rim LockOpen the Door: Start by unlocking.Detach the Lock: Unscrew the screws holding the rim lock in place. Keep these screws, as they may be used for the new lock.Remove Lock Components: Gently take out the rim lock from the door.Step 3: Prepare the DoorExamine the Mortise: Check the mortise where the old lock was installed. Guarantee it is devoid of debris and damage.Sculpt if Necessary: If the new lock requires a various size or shape, use a wood sculpt to make changes to the mortise.Step 4: Install the New Rim LockPosition the New Lock: Align the new rim Lock Replacement lock in place over the existing mortise.Connect the Lock: Secure the rim lock to the door utilizing screws. Guarantee it is tight to avoid wobbling.Test the Mechanism: Before closing the door completely, check if the lock turns efficiently with the secret.Step 5: Make Adjustments
If the lock does not operate efficiently, adjust the position and ensure it has been effectively secured.

The procedure generally takes about 30 minutes to an hour, depending on your familiarity with the tools and the trouble of the existing lock's removal.
Can I set up a rim lock myself?
Yes, changing a rim lock is a task that can be handled by most homeowners with basic tools and skills.
What should I do if my new rim lock doesn't fit?
Inspect the lock's requirements versus your door's measurements. You might require to modify the mortise or acquire a different rim lock that matches your door's dimensions.
Are rim locks enough to secure my home?
While rim locks add an extra layer of security, they work best in conjunction with additional security measures like deadbolts, security video cameras, and correct lighting.
